Arrow HSANZ PhD Scholarship Awarded – Congratulations Dr Michael Ashby!

Congratulations to Dr Michael Ashby of Alfred Health who has been awarded the Arrow HSANZ PhD Scholarship for 2024 for his research into “Preventing Acute Myeloid Leukaemia relapse following allogeneic stem cell transplant.” About the study: Michael’s PhD project will study methods of preventing relapse of acute myeloid leukaemia (AML) after a bone marrow transplant.
